What is Form I-9
The USCIS Form I-9 is a government form used by employers to verify the identity and employment authorization of individuals hired to work in the United States.

What is the USCIS Form I-9 Employment Eligibility Verification?
The USCIS Form I-9 is a government form used in the employment eligibility verification process. Its primary purpose is to confirm that individuals hired in the United States are authorized to work. Completing the form is crucial for both employees and employers to ensure compliance with federal regulations.
The form consists of distinct sections where employees provide personal information and employers validate that information. It serves as an essential tool in maintaining lawful employment practices.

What are the eligibility requirements for completing the Form I-9?
Individuals must provide proof of their identity and employment authorization in the U.S. This usually includes submitting documents like a passport or a driver's license, along with a social security card.
Are there deadlines for submitting the Form I-9?
Employers must complete the Form I-9 for each new employee within three days of their start date. It's important to ensure timely completion to comply with legal requirements.
How do I submit the completed Form I-9?
The Form I-9 should be retained by the employer and not submitted to USCIS unless requested. Check with your employer for specific submission methods regarding record-keeping.

How long does it take to process the Form I-9?
The Form I-9 does not require processing by USCIS but must be completed and kept by the employer. Ensure it is finalized and stored appropriately according to legal guidelines.
